General annotation (Comments)

Function

Hydrolyzes the N-acetamido groups of N-acetyl-D-glucosamine residues in chitin.

Catalytic activity

Chitin + H2O = chitosan + acetate.

Sequence similarities

Belongs to the polysaccharide deacetylase family.

Caution

The protein characterized in Ref.2 is not a chitin deacetylase, the peptides sequenced being copurified contaminants of the protein under study.
